Abstract

The application of a novel chromatographic approach to therapeutic peptides bearing basic amino acids in their structure allowed unprecedented resolution of their related impurities (including epimeric isobaric ones), resulting in a superior analytical tool for the evaluation of the quality of these drugs in the market.
